Oil Furnace Replacement in Columbus, OH
Oil furnace replacement services involve removing an outdated or malfunctioning oil-fired heating system and installing a new unit to ensure reliable warmth throughout the property. This type of project typically covers the complete removal of the existing furnace, assessment of the current ductwork and ventilation, and the installation of a compatible, energy-efficient oil furnace. Property owners often seek this service when their current system is no longer functioning properly, is costly to repair, or when upgrading to a more efficient heating solution to improve comfort and reduce energy expenses.
Before requesting an oil furnace replacement, homeowners usually want to understand the size and capacity of the new furnace needed for their home, as well as the compatibility with existing ductwork and ventilation systems. It’s also important to consider the type of oil furnace that best suits the property’s heating demands and to inquire about the overall installation process, including any necessary modifications to existing infrastructure. Clear information about the scope of work and expected outcomes can help property owners make informed decisions about upgrading their heating systems.

Oil Furnace Replacement Questions
When should an oil furnace be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the furnace shows frequent breakdowns, declining efficiency, or age beyond its typical lifespan.
What are signs that indicate a new oil furnace is needed? Unusual noises, uneven heating, or rising energy bills can suggest it's time for a replacement.
How does replacing an oil furnace improve home comfort? A new furnace provides more reliable heat, better temperature control, and increased energy efficiency.
What should property owners consider before replacing an oil furnace? Evaluating the furnace's condition, energy savings potential, and compatibility with existing ductwork helps inform the decision.
